The fox population in a certain region has an annual growth rate of 5 percent per year. It is estimated that the population in the year 2000 was 23500 . (a) Find a function in the form \( P(t)=a b^{t}
The fox population can be modeled using an exponential growth function of the form P(t) = ab^t, where P(t) represents the population at time t, a is the initial population, b is the growth factor, and t represents the number of years.
In this case, the population in the year 2000 was given as 23500. We can use this information to find the values of a and b in the exponential growth function. Since the population has an annual growth rate of 5 percent, the growth factor (b) would be 1 + growth rate = 1 + 0.05 = 1.05.
To find the value of a, we substitute the given population value for the year 2000 into the exponential growth function: P(0) = ab^0 = a(1.05)^0 = a. Therefore, a = 23500.
Now we have the values of a and b, and the exponential growth function for the fox population becomes P(t) = 23500 * (1.05)^t, where t represents the number of years since the year 2000.
This function can be used to estimate the fox population for any given year after 2000 by substituting the desired value of t into the equation.

When a DNA sequence is permanently rendered inaccessible to transcription via methylation and chromatin modifications, we call this:
a) silencing;
b) imprinting;
c) quiescence;
d) a Barr body;
e) inactivation.
When a DNA sequence is permanently rendered inaccessible to transcription via methylation and chromatin modifications, we call this "silencing". So the correct option is A .
DNA methylation and chromatin modifications are epigenetic mechanisms that can regulate gene expression by altering the structure of the DNA molecule and/or the surrounding chromatin. When a specific DNA sequence is methylated or modified in such a way that it becomes permanently inaccessible to transcription factors and RNA polymerase, the gene is said to be "silenced". This can occur during development, as cells differentiate and acquire specialized functions, or in response to environmental stimuli. Silencing of certain genes has been linked to various diseases, including cancer and genetic disorders, highlighting the importance of understanding epigenetic regulation in normal and pathological contexts.

what is the correct order of protein production?
1) ribosome
2) endoplasmic reticulum
3) secretory vesicles
4) golgy apparatus
a) 1,2,3,4
b) 2,4,3,1
c) 1,2,4,3
d) 3,2,4,1
Answer:
The correct order of protein production is:
c) 1,2,4,3
Ribosome: Protein synthesis begins in the ribosomes, which are located either in the cytoplasm or attached to the endoplasmic reticulum.
Endoplasmic Reticulum: After the initial stages of protein synthesis in the ribosomes, the newly synthesized protein is transported into the endoplasmic reticulum (ER) for further processing and modification.
Golgi Apparatus: The proteins synthesized in the ER undergo further processing and modifications in the Golgi apparatus. This includes sorting, packaging, and modifying the proteins to their final functional forms.
Secretory Vesicles: Once the proteins are properly processed and modified in the Golgi apparatus, they are packaged into secretory vesicles. These vesicles transport the proteins to their destination, such as the plasma membrane for secretion outside the cell.
Therefore, the correct order is 1, 2, 4, 3.
